GEOTOURISM

 
DESCRIPTION

Andalusia has an important geological heritage, counting on a great variety of geological areas and processes, many of them exceptional in the national and international context. These places of geological interest are listed in the Andalusian Inventory of Georecourses, with more than 662 georecourses. 

 

The objective of this section is to present the most representative, singular or exclusive elements of the geological record of Andalusia. In general, these are places of high landscape interest or that show spectacular active processes that attract the attention of the public , which, in general, is not aware of the participation of geology in the configuration of those landscapes or the geological functioning of the processes you are observing in those places.

 

First of all, for geodiversity lovers, we suggest a visit to the three Unesco World Geoparks in Andalusia , about which you can find more information on this web portal:

 

- The Unesco Sierras Subbéticas World Geopark: This offers the visitor the opportunity to walk on the bottom of an ancient sea of warm and transparent waters from hundreds of millions of years ago, whose fauna has reached us today in form of fossils (ammonites). Sierras Subbéticas is the kingdom of ammonites and a worldwide reference. Likewise, the subsequent karstification of these rocks gave rise to a landscape of singular beauty, with sinkholes, lapiaces, poljes, canyons, waterfalls, fountains, springs and endless caves and underground galleries. Sierras Subbéticas is the kingdom of karst and ammonites.

- The Cabo de Gata-Níjar Unesco World Geopark: It is a geological gem with the best examples of underwater volcanism in the entire Western Mediterranean, the result of the clash between Africa and Europe millions of years ago. Not forgetting the fossil reefs.

- The Sierra Norte de Sevilla Unesco World Geopark: is a rich geological and mining heritage, with rocks of very old ages that show 700 million years of the Earth's history. Among the many places of geological interest in this territory, impressive rock formations produced by the action of the atmosphere and water stand out: karst, berrocales, waterfalls, gorges, canyons. It is worth highlighting the Cerro del Hierro.
